Application Information
| Applications accepted |
Instructions: each child under 2 years of age shall have an initial health examination not more than 6 months prior to nor later than 3months after being admitted to the center and a follow-up health examination at least once every 6 months after admission. except for a school-aged child, each child 2 years of age or older shall have an initial health examination not more than one year prior to nor later than 3 months after being admitted to a center and a follow-up health examination at least once every 2 years after admission.
state law requires all children in day care centers to present evidence of immunization against certain diseases within 30 school days (6 calendar weeks) of admission to the day care center. these requirements can be waived only if a properly signed health, religious, or personal conviction waiver is filed with the day care center. see “waivers” below. if you have any questions on immunizations or how to complete this form, please contact your child's day care provider or your local health department.
entering half-day preschool-4 years old by jan. 1
enter k4 program-4 years old by sept. 1
entering k5 program-5 years old by sept. 1 |

School Philosophy & Day in the Life
School Philosophy and Mission
"We desire to meet the needs of the whole child and to promote spiritual and moral growth, academic and intellectual progress, and physical and social development. Our emphasis is high quality education combined with the knowledge that God's principles are the confirming basis for our actions and understanding.
Capitoland Christian School is operated as a ministry of Capitoland Christian Center. The Church, along with the school, is non-denominational, and admits students of any background.
Our kindergarten and elementary curriculum covers language arts, math, science, social studies, health and Bible. Bible is an important part of our teaching, as our primary objective in teaching Bible is the development of Christ-like behavior in each student. Our weekly Chapel program is designed to reinforce and supplement the teaching of the Bible through word and song. Curriculum and textbook materials are taken from Bob Jones University Press and A Beka Books. Art, physical education, and music are also taught once a week to enable students to develop their abilities in a wide range of activities.
Teachers and staff members function as role models for students. The professional preparation of the instructional staff is a part of the school's testimony and its commitment to parents to provide quality instruction for its students. The low student to teacher ratio also allows for more individual attention to each student.
Capitoland Christian School has the responsibility to provide the best education possible. As Christian educators, we desire to teach each student to accept individual responsibility to God for their actions and to challenge them to glorify God in every facet of their life.
